Transaction 85959a9f4d856466829e32d39103805d727677a8ab02d396282c607a0fef1e02
1 Input
1 Output
-
85959a9f4d856466829e32d39103805d727677a8ab02d396282c607a0fef1e02:0
- value
- 552902
- script pubkey
- OP_0 OP_PUSHBYTES_20 70bebe5d394b60bb05ae3096ea21011c19912fb4
- address
- bc1qwzltuhfefdstkpdwxztw5ggprsvezta59eeemh